Epic Games is seeking a highly motivated, experienced Senior Tools Programmer to join the Unreal Engine UI Systems team. This role involves designing and improving the UI content creation pipeline, tools, and engine runtime capabilities used across Unreal Engine (UE) and Unreal Engine for Fortnite (UEFN). The successful candidate will have a central role in developing UI systems tools, including WYSIWYG editors, UI APIs/frameworks, and core runtime UI capabilities, impacting millions of users and players.
Own, develop, improve, and optimize the code of UI technology used to build tools and in-game UI in Unreal Engine.,Collaborate with programmers, artists, UI, and UX designers to identify areas for improvement, gather feedback, and design solutions for customer needs.,Analyze and fix common problems in a game engine, such as performance issues and memory usage.,Work collaboratively across many of Epic's internal teams.,Work with Unreal Engine's licensees to enable them to overcome their challenges.
Strong C++ skills and experience working within large codebases.,Experience designing and writing tools that improve the customer's user experience, iteration, and development time in game development or other fields.,Demonstrate in-depth understanding of tools development, UI Frameworks, and runtime UI engines.,Ability to work effectively in a team, coupled with strong problem-solving skills.,Demonstrated ability to communicate fluently in English, both written and verbal, with excellent interpersonal skills.
Epic Games is an American video game and software developer and publisher based in Cary, North Carolina. The company is best known for developing the Unreal Engine, the globally popular game Fortnite, and operating the Epic Games Store digital storefront.
BerryMap uses cookies to provide essential features, analyze usage, and improve your experience. You can customize your preferences below.